They booked King Bed, which overrides all other categories and locations (including preferred buildings, river or pool views). So they could legitimately request any King Bed room in the Alligator Bayou section (it needs to be there for the 3 people option). That's any AB room coloured purple in my floorplan layouts, even the ones in buildings 14 or 18.

I'd suggest outlining the details of what would be ideal in the fax request, and use a room number in building 18 as an example of the perfect match. That way, if that room does happen to be free they might be assigned it, or otherwise the room assignment team know how to look for a close match.

I highly recommend Wolfgang Express in the Marketplace area of DTD. The quality of the food is excellent! If you happen to be on the Disney Dining Plan, it counts as a quick service meal even though a server delivers your food to the table (you do order at the counter).

I'd recommend that you arrive before rope drop at AK. You should be able to leave AK at around 3 or 3:30 & have plenty of time to get to DTD, if driving there, & to eat at WGP Express and get to La Nouba 1/2 hour early.
